Iraq Launches Ambitious Plan to Attract $250 Billion in Investments

Admin Admin September 1, 2026

The National Investment Commission of Iraq has announced a strategic plan aimed at attracting investments worth up to $250 billion over the next two years. This plan includes a wide range of investment projects in vital sectors, with the goal of enhancing economic diversification and reducing dependence on oil as the primary source of revenue.

Targeted Sectors and Planned Projects

The investment package prepared by the National Investment Commission includes projects in various fields, such as:

  • Renewable Energy: Projects to generate energy from renewable sources, such as solar and wind power, to meet Iraq’s energy needs and reduce carbon emissions.
  • Industrial and Agricultural Cities: Development of specialized industrial and agricultural zones to boost local production and create new job opportunities.
  • Rail Networks: Construction and development of a railway network connecting major cities, contributing to improved transportation and reduced traffic congestion.
  • Education, Communications, Tourism, and Entertainment: Projects in these sectors aim to improve infrastructure and enhance services provided to citizens.

Progress and Challenges

According to Haider Makia, head of the National Investment Commission, the necessary requirements for 103 investment opportunities have been completed so far, with major future projects currently in planning.

Despite the progress, Iraq faces challenges related to project financing and allocating the required land for implementation. The commission is working in coordination with the Ministry of Finance to address these challenges and facilitate investment attraction.

Legislative Reforms and Investment Environment

To enhance the investment environment, the commission has updated investment-related legislation, including amending the Iraqi Investment Law and activating the “one-stop shop” to simplify administrative procedures.

Iraq has also joined international agreements to protect and encourage investment, reflecting its commitment to providing a secure and transparent investment environment.

Iraq Investment Forum

The commission intends to organize the “Iraq Investment Forum” in Baghdad, where available investment opportunities will be presented to local and foreign companies. The forum aims to strengthen economic cooperation and attract more investments to Iraq.
